The Knights Templar is a military religious order created during the First Crusade and are the sworn enemies of the Assassins. The order survives through the Third Crusade and exists through the Renaissance even until Modern Times (2012).

Ideals and Goals

The Knights Templar originally sought lasting peace the Christian way. However, with their discovery of the Pieces of Eden, they changed. As powerful religious and political figures spread their lies, they realized that there is no God or Great Power out there, only men with power and those without. They became Atheists, while maintaining the pretense and tradition of Roman Catholics and retaining friends in the Vatican to avoid suspicion and for personal habit. With no afterlife or ultimate punishment or reward after death, there was no real reason to oblige by such morality. It also made them perceive that only this life was important, rather than preparing for a non-existent next life. With this new view, the corruption of the world shone to them like an ugly light. With so many lower class people kept in line with the promise of a next life and so many upper class men blissfully ignoring such ideals, the Templars vowed to make a better world, one of lasting peace, no matter the cost. This lasting peace, as they thought, would be brought about by the Pieces of Eden, where they intend to use it to make everyone usher in a world of forced but lasting peace.

The Historical Templars

Ordre du Temple in French, the Knights Templar are amongst the most famous of the Western Christian military orders involved in the war. They are well known by the distinctive white mantles with a red cross. Officially endorsed by the Roman Catholic Church around 1129, the Order became a favored charity throughout Christianity, and grew rapidly in membership. Because the Templars' existence was tied closely to the Crusades; when the Holy Land was lost, support for the Order faded.

They were among the most skilled fighters at the time, which is reflected in the game. Their ruthlessness against non-Catholics was also infamous; this also is reflected in the game.
